BESS Bimergen Energy

BESS is trying to become the battery-storage equivalent of a power plant developer.

Bimergen is developing utility-scale battery energy storage systems (BESS). These giant battery installations store electricity when power is abundant and cheap, then discharge it when demand and prices are higher. The batteries help stabilize the grid and support renewable energy sources like wind and solar.

Imagine if cars had nowhere to park and had to keep driving around all day. Parking garages would become incredibly valuable. Battery storage does the same thing for electricity. It gives power a place to “park” until it’s needed.

Bimergen’s bet is that owning thousands of megawatt-hours of parking space for electricity will become one of the most valuable pieces of the future energy grid.

The market is valuing Bimergen as a tiny company today, but if it successfully develops even a portion of its multi-gigawatt battery pipeline, it could become a meaningful owner of energy infrastructure.

FEMY Femasys

Femasys has two potentially disruptive women’s health technologies. .

FemaSeed is an advanced fertility treatment designed to deliver sperm directly into the fallopian tube, the natural site of conception, potentially improving fertilization rates while offering a far lower cost and lower risk alternative to IVF or ICSI. The technology is already approved across major markets including the U.S., Europe, U.K., Canada, and Israel.

FemBloc is a first-of-its-kind non-surgical permanent birth control procedure that uses a proprietary biodegradable polymer to create scar tissue that permanently blocks the fallopian tubes, eliminating the need for surgical sterilization. Unlike older approaches, it avoids implanted metal devices and is designed as a lower-cost in-office procedure with fewer risks and recovery issues.

The biggest issue facing the stock is that despite the compelling technology and large market opportunity, commercial adoption and revenue growth remain limited so far, causing investors to question whether the company can successfully scale physician usage, reimbursement, and patient demand before needing additional financing.

NSPR InspireMD

CLUSTER INSIDER BUYING

InspireMD is trying to solve one of the biggest problems in carotid artery stenting, preventing strokes caused by debris breaking loose after a stent is implanted.

The key innovation is the patented “MicroNet” mesh layer. Instead of relying only on metal struts like older stents, CGuard adds an ultra-fine PET mesh covering with pore sizes around 150 to 180 microns. That mesh acts like a filter that traps plaque and blood clot material against the artery wall before it can travel to the brain.

InspireMD is not just selling another stent. They are trying to create what they believe could become the next-generation standard for carotid artery intervention.

QTI QT Imaging Holdings

QTI is targeting one of the biggest problems in breast cancer screening: dense breast tissue. About 40% of women have dense breasts, which can make cancers harder to detect on mammograms because both dense tissue and tumors appear white on the scan.

In preliminary Mayo Clinic comparisons, QT’s imaging reportedly detected all findings identified by MRI, while also potentially reducing unnecessary biopsies by improving tissue characterization.

They have proprietary “speed-of-sound” imaging technology.

QTI recently secured a Category III CPT reimbursement code that becomes effective January 1, 2027, which is viewed as the first major step toward future insurance coverage.
